php的select语句怎么输出

php的select语句怎么输出,第1张

php中要查询mysql数据库中的内容需要SELECT语句

语句1:SELECT *  FROM table_name

解说:意思就是读取整个表table_name里面的数据显示出来

语句2:SELECT * FROM table_name Where x = 1

解说:意思就是读取表table_name里面键名为:x 值为:1的 数据显示出来

Select 查询语句的例子

<?php

$con = mysql_connect("localhost","peter","abc123")

if (!$con)

  {

  die('Could not connect: ' . mysql_error())

  }

mysql_select_db("my_db", $con)

$result = mysql_query("SELECT * FROM Persons")

while($row = mysql_fetch_array($result))

  {

  echo $row['FirstName'] . " " . $row['LastName']

  echo "<br />"

  }

mysql_close($con)

?>

比如一张表中有2个字段,id和name,现在你把这张表中的所有的值都取出来放在一个二维数组$arr中了,那么现在来遍历这个$arr数组

echo "<select name=''>"

foreach($arr as $key=>$vo){

    echo "<option value=$vo['id']>$vo['name']</option>"

}

echo "</select>"

遍历就是这样了,当然我是用echo 输出的了,记得要写在一对<select></select>的里面


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9720568.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-01
下一篇 2023-05-01

发表评论

登录后才能评论

评论列表(0条)

保存